Platinum Kush is an indica-dominant hybrid known for its potent sedative effects, high resin production, and luxurious frosty appearance. It is revered by both recreational and medical cannabis users for its powerful body relaxation, stress relief, and pain management properties.
- Genetics: Predominantly Indica (90%), with some Sativa (10%) influence.
- Parent Strains: Thought to be a cross between OG Kush and an unknown Afghan Indica.
- THC Content: Typically 18% – 22%, but can reach up to 26% in optimized growing conditions.
- CBD Content: Generally low, around 0.2% – 1%.
- CBG Content: Around 1% – 2% in some phenotypes.
Appearance, Aroma, and Flavor
Appearance
Platinum Kush stands out due to its dense, compact buds covered in silvery-white trichomes, giving it a “platinum” look. The purple hues, dark green leaves, and bright orange pistils add to its striking visual appeal.
Aroma
- Earthy and sweet with hints of skunky pine and floral undertones.
- Pungent kush scent with a light citrus note upon grinding.
Flavor
- Sweet and creamy with spicy herbal notes.
- Berry-like aftertaste with a smooth, buttery finish.
- Some phenotypes have a grape-like flavor due to anthocyanin-rich genetics.

Methods of Ingestion
The primary ways to consume Platinum Kush include inhalation, oral consumption, and sublingual administration. Each method has distinct physiological effects due to differences in absorption rates and cannabinoid metabolism.
A. Inhalation (Smoking & Vaping)

Mechanism
- Cannabinoids enter the pulmonary alveoli and diffuse into the bloodstream.
- Bypasses first-pass metabolism, resulting in rapid onset.
Onset and Duration
- Onset: 1-5 minutes
- Peak Effects: 30-60 minutes
- Total Duration: 2-4 hours
Bioavailability
- Smoking: ~30% bioavailability (varies based on technique and lung efficiency).
- Vaping: 35-50% bioavailability due to higher cannabinoid retention and less combustion waste.
Scientific Insights
- Vaporization is more efficient than smoking, as combustion destroys up to 50% of THC.
- Vaporizers heat cannabis to 160-230°C, releasing cannabinoids without producing harmful tar and carcinogens.
Best For
- Immediate symptom relief (pain, anxiety, insomnia).
- Users preferring controlled dosage and instant effects.
B. Oral Consumption (Edibles & Capsules)
Mechanism
- THC and other cannabinoids are absorbed in the small intestine, then metabolized by the liver (first-pass metabolism).
- Δ9-THC is converted to 11-hydroxy-THC, which is more potent and longer-lasting.

Onset and Duration
- Onset: 30-90 minutes
- Peak Effects: 2-3 hours
- Total Duration: 6-10 hours (can extend to 12 hours in high doses)
Bioavailability
- Oral THC bioavailability is lower (~4-20%) due to enzymatic degradation and first-pass metabolism.
Scientific Insights
- 11-hydroxy-THC is 2-3 times more psychoactive than Δ9-THC, leading to stronger sedative effects.
- Absorption rates vary based on fat content in food; consuming edibles with lipids (butter, coconut oil, MCT oil) improves cannabinoid absorption.
Best For
- Long-lasting effects (chronic pain, sleep disorders).
- Microdosing, since lower doses produce milder, prolonged relief.
C. Sublingual (Tinctures & Sprays)
Mechanism
- Cannabinoids absorb directly into capillaries under the tongue, bypassing first-pass metabolism.

Onset and Duration
- Onset: 10-30 minutes
- Peak Effects: 1-2 hours
- Total Duration: 4-6 hours
Bioavailability
- Sublingual THC absorption ranges from 10-35%, depending on solvent type and carrier oil.
- Alcohol-based tinctures have higher bioavailability than oil-based ones.
Scientific Insights
- Sublingual administration is faster than edibles but longer-lasting than smoking.
- Terpene retention is higher, leading to enhanced therapeutic effects.
Best For
- Users needing faster onset than edibles but longer duration than smoking.
- Precise dosing with minimal lung irritation.
D. Topical and Transdermal Applications
Mechanism
- Cannabinoids in Platinum Kush penetrate the dermis and interact with CB2 receptors in the skin.
- Cannabinoids can reach the bloodstream through transdermal patches to produce systemic effects.
Onset and Duration
- Onset: 15-60 minutes (depends on formulation)
- Peak Effects: 1-2 hours
- Total Duration: 6-12 hours (transdermal patches last longer)
Bioavailability
- Local topicals have minimal systemic absorption (~5% bioavailability).
- Transdermal patches can achieve higher systemic absorption (up to 40%).
Scientific Insights
- Lipid-based formulations of Platinum Kush (lotions, creams) are better absorbed.
- Transdermal carriers (liposomes, micelles) improve cannabinoid penetration through the skin.
Best For
- Localized pain relief (arthritis, muscle soreness, inflammation).
- Avoiding psychoactive effects, as most topicals do not cross the blood-brain barrier.
Comparison of Ingestion Methods
| Method | Onset | Peak | Duration | Bioavailability | Best For |
|---|---|---|---|---|---|
| Smoking | 1-5 min | 30-60 min | 2-4 hours | 30% | Immediate relief |
| Vaping | 1-5 min | 30-60 min | 2-4 hours | 35-50% | Fast-acting, efficient use |
| Edibles | 30-90 min | 2-3 hours | 6-10 hours | 4-20% | Long-lasting effects |
| Sublingual | 10-30 min | 1-2 hours | 4-6 hours | 10-35% | Quick but sustained relief |
| Topicals | 15-60 min | 1-2 hours | 6-12 hours | ~5% (local), up to 40% (transdermal) | Localized relief |
Factors Influencing Onset and Duration
Metabolism and Body Composition
- Individuals with higher body fat may retain cannabinoids of Platinum Kush longer, affecting elimination half-life.
- Metabolic rate influences onset, with faster metabolism leading to quicker absorption.
Tolerance Levels
- Frequent users metabolize THC faster, leading to a shorter duration of effects.
- First-time users may experience prolonged effects due to lower cannabinoid receptor desensitization.
Food Intake
- Edibles taken on an empty stomach of Platinum Kush are absorbed faster but may result in intense effects.
- Fat-rich meals enhance THC bioavailability, leading to stronger and longer-lasting effects.
Delivery Method and Formulation
- Nano-emulsified cannabinoids (water-soluble THC) have faster absorption rates.
- Liposomal encapsulation improves bioavailability in oral and sublingual formulations.
Scientific Considerations on THC Metabolism
First-Pass Metabolism in Oral Ingestion
- Δ9-THC is converted to 11-hydroxy-THC in the liver via the cytochrome P450 enzyme system.
- 11-hydroxy-THC crosses the blood-brain barrier more efficiently, leading to stronger effects than inhaled THC.
Plasma Concentration and Half-Life
- Inhaled THC: Rapid peak plasma concentration (~10-15 minutes).
- Oral THC: Delayed peak plasma concentration (1-3 hours).
- Half-life of THC: 20-30 hours, but metabolites remain in fat stores for days to weeks.
Medical Benefits
Platinum Kush is widely used in medical cannabis programs due to its potent pain-relieving, anti-anxiety, and sedative effects.
Primary Medical Uses
| Condition | Effectiveness |
|---|---|
| Chronic Pain | 5/5 |
| Insomnia | 5/5 |
| Stress & Anxiety | 5/5 |
| Depression | 4/5 |
| Appetite Stimulation | 3/5 |
| Muscle Spasms & Cramps | 5/5 |
Pain Relief
Platinum Kush is a top choice for chronic pain sufferers, especially those with:
- Fibromyalgia
- Arthritis
- Neuropathy
- Migraines
Its high myrcene and caryophyllene content make it an excellent natural analgesic.
Anxiety and Stress Reduction
- High limonene and linalool content provides calming effects.
- Helps reduce intrusive thoughts and overthinking.
- Best for generalized anxiety, PTSD, and social anxiety.
Sleep Disorders & Insomnia
- One of the most effective cannabis strains for inducing sleep.
- Helps those with chronic insomnia and REM sleep disturbances.
Gastrointestinal Disorders & Appetite
- Mild appetite stimulation, helpful for nausea and IBS sufferers.
- Less potent for severe appetite loss compared to strains like Granddaddy Purple.
Scientific Insights & Pharmacology
Platinum Kush’s biological and chemical properties have been studied for their pharmacological effects.
Neurochemical Interactions
- THC: Binds to CB1 receptors in the brain, leading to sedation and euphoria.
- CBD & CBG: Modulate CB2 receptor activity, reducing inflammation.
- Terpenes: Act synergistically with cannabinoids in the entourage effect.
Impact on Brain Regions
| Brain Area | Effect |
|---|---|
| Amygdala | Reduces stress, anxiety |
| Hippocampus | Induces short-term memory impairment |
| Cerebral Cortex | Mild cognitive slowing |
| Basal Ganglia | Muscle relaxation, reduced tremors |
Cultivation Information
Environmental Conditions for Optimal Growth
Platinum Kush requires specific temperature, humidity, light, and soil conditions to maximize yield, potency, and terpene production.
a. Temperature and Humidity Control
- Vegetative Stage:
- Temperature: 22-28°C (72-82°F)
- Relative Humidity (RH): 50-65%
- CO₂ Enrichment: 1000-1500 ppm (optional for accelerated growth)
- Flowering Stage:
- Temperature: 20-26°C (68-78°F)
- Relative Humidity (RH): 40-50% (to prevent mold and increase resin production)
- CO₂ Enrichment: 800-1200 ppm (to enhance bud density)
- Late Flowering (Final 2 Weeks):
- Temperature: 18-22°C (65-72°F)
- Humidity: 30-40%
- Cold Shock (Optional): Exposing plants to 16°C (60°F) at night enhances anthocyanin production, bringing out deep purple hues in the buds.
Light Spectrum and Photoperiod
Platinum Kush, being an indica-heavy strain, requires a strong light source to maximize resin and THC production.
a. Vegetative Stage (18/6 light cycle)
- Optimal Light Spectrum:
- Blue Light: 400-500 nm (Encourages strong root and leaf growth)
- Ideal for LED and Metal Halide (MH) lights.
- Light Intensity:
- PPFD (Photosynthetic Photon Flux Density): 400-600 µmol/m²/s
- DLI (Daily Light Integral): 30-40 mol/m²/day
b. Flowering Stage (12/12 light cycle)
- Optimal Light Spectrum:
- Red Light: 600-700 nm (Enhances bud development and terpene synthesis)
- Infrared (Far-Red): 700-750 nm (Triggers flowering stretch, leading to denser buds)
- Light Intensity:
- PPFD: 600-1000 µmol/m²/s
- DLI: 40-60 mol/m²/day
- Preferred Light Sources:
- HPS (High-Pressure Sodium) lights (for large-scale cultivation)
- Full-spectrum LED lights (for energy efficiency and enhanced terpene production)
Cultivation Mediums and Nutrient Management
a. Growing Medium
Platinum Kush thrives in organic soil or hydroponic setups, depending on the desired terpene expression and cannabinoid potency.
| Growing Medium | Advantages | Disadvantages |
|---|---|---|
| Organic Soil | Rich terpene profile, improved flavor | Slower growth, requires microbial balance |
| Coco Coir | Faster root development, good aeration | Needs daily nutrient supplementation |
| Hydroponics | Maximum yield, precise nutrient control | Higher risk of root rot, requires constant monitoring |
| Aeroponics | High oxygenation, rapid growth | Complex system, costly setup |
b. Nutrient Requirements
Macronutrients (N-P-K Ratio)
- Vegetative Stage:Nitrogen (N) – 3, Phosphorus (P) – 1, Potassium (K) – 2
- Encourages strong root and leaf growth.
- Early Flowering Stage:N – 1, P – 3, K – 3
- Boosts bud sites and resin production.
- Late Flowering Stage:N – 0, P – 2, K – 4
- Enhances trichome development and terpene expression.
Micronutrients (Essential for Maximum THC & Terpene Production)
- Magnesium (Mg): Aids in chlorophyll production.
- Calcium (Ca): Strengthens cell walls and enhances bud density.
- Sulfur (S): Essential for terpenoid and flavonoid synthesis.
- Silicon (Si): Increases resistance to pests and stress.
Advanced Cultivation Techniques
a. Training Techniques for High Yield
- Low-Stress Training (LST):
- Gently bending stems to expose lower bud sites to light.
- Enhances light penetration and airflow, reducing mold risks.
- Screen of Green (ScrOG):
- Training branches horizontally using a net.
- Encourages even canopy growth and maximizes light exposure.
- Supercropping:
- Gently crushing branches to redirect energy to bud production.
- Triggers increased THC and trichome formation.
- Defoliation:
- Removing unnecessary fan leaves to enhance airflow and light penetration.
- Best done during early flowering for denser, trichome-rich buds.
Pest and Disease Management
Platinum Kush is naturally resistant to mold and mildew, but pests and root diseases can still be an issue.
a. Common Pests
| Pest | Prevention & Treatment |
|---|---|
| Spider Mites | Neem oil, predatory mites (Phytoseiulus persimilis) |
| Fungus Gnats | Bacillus thuringiensis (BT), yellow sticky traps |
| Aphids | Ladybugs, insecticidal soap |
| Thrips | Pyrethrin sprays, Spinosad |
b. Common Diseases
| Disease | Prevention & Treatment |
|---|---|
| Powdery Mildew | Reduce humidity, apply sulfur sprays |
| Root Rot | Ensure proper drainage, use beneficial fungi (Mycorrhizae) |
| Bud Rot (Botrytis) | Increase airflow, remove infected buds immediately |
Harvesting and Post-Harvest Processing
a. Best Time to Harvest
Platinum Kush reaches full maturity 8-9 weeks after flowering begins.
- Trichome Color Check:
- Clear Trichomes: Too early.
- Milky White Trichomes: Peak THC potency.
- Amber Trichomes: More sedative, higher CBN content.
b. Drying and Curing Process
- Drying Stage (7-10 Days)
- Temperature: 18-22°C (65-72°F)
- Humidity: 45-55%
- Keep in dark, well-ventilated space with gentle air circulation.
- Curing Stage (2-6 Weeks)
- Store buds in glass jars at 60-65% humidity.
- Burp jars daily for the first 2 weeks to release moisture.
- This enhances flavor, smoothness, and terpene profile.
Enhancing Cannabinoid and Terpene Production
- UVB Light Exposure: Studies suggest that UVB radiation (280-315 nm) increases THC concentration IN Platinum Kush by triggering plant defense mechanisms.
- Drought Stressing (Final 2 Weeks): Reducing water intake boosts trichome density.
- Terpene Boosting Techniques:
- Supplement soil with kelp extracts, molasses, and sulfur.
- Cold shocking (dropping nighttime temps to 14-16°C) enhances anthocyanin production.

Comparisons with Similar Strains
| Strain | THC | CBD | Effects | Best Use |
|---|---|---|---|---|
| Platinum Kush | 18-26% | <1% | Sedative, euphoric, relaxing | Nighttime |
| Granddaddy Purple | 19-23% | <1% | Heavy body high, dreamy | Insomnia, pain |
| Bubba Kush | 20-25% | <1% | Calming, happy, sleepy | Stress, anxiety |
| Purple Punch | 18-22% | <1% | Sedating, muscle relief | Chronic pain |
